A kind of thread mechanism for processing plastic pipe
Technical field
The utility model relates to field of mechanical technique, espespecially provide a kind of thread mechanism for processing plastic pipe.
Background technique
Common tubing screw thread process is based on fixing tubing tubing, then by manually acting on silk mouth Tool be made to realize, the disadvantage is that precision is not high, and is difficult to automated job, be unfavorable for improved products quality, also not Production capacity can be improved, and complicated for operation, the mold (such as turntable, cutterhead) used need to be replaced frequently, while need vice in operation It is matched for clamping tightly, operation trouble, manufacturing cost is high.

Please refer to Fig. 1 and Fig. 2, provided in figure it is a kind of by plastic pipe be processed into threaded joints equipment (with Lower abbreviation " equipment "), which includes base 100, vertical, horizontal slide block mechanism (hereinafter referred to as " slide block mechanism ") 10, rib machine Structure 20 and tubing clamp system (hereinafter referred to as " clamp system ") 30, wherein:Slide block mechanism 10 is set close to 100 back edge of base Set, and there is the sliding block (not shown or do not mark) that can be achieved all around to shift, sliding block be from left and right to sliding block and front and back to Sliding block is formed with superposition state, and is realized and sliding driving device (not shown or do not mark) driving and all around shifted;Spiral shell Line mechanism 20 is located on the sliding block of the top of slide block mechanism 10 top, and including rotating device (not shown or do not mark), rotating device Left-right situs has the first drive axis (not shown) and the second drive axis (not shown), drives second and is equipped with (reply tubular object extruding end on axis ) internal diameter cutter 22, it is driven first and is equipped with (reply tubular object extruding end) tri-claw plate 23 on axis, tri-claw plate 23 is adjusted to be clamped The internal thread cutter 231 of different size (after such as meeting the processing of internal diameter cutter 22) size;Clamp system 30 is relative to slide block mechanism 10 It is located at the leading edge close to base 100, clamp system 30 can effectively clamp plastic pipe to be processed (not shown) one end, pass through Adjustment slide block mechanism 10 can make internal diameter cutter 22 and tri-claw plate 23 be able to precisely align under the drive of its slide block mechanism 10 The plastic pipe end face (or " section "), such as:When starting the control device of the equipment, first internal diameter cutter 22 is adjusted to It is directed at plastic pipe end face, the progressive forward movement of slide block mechanism 10 is allowed to internal diameter cutter 22 to firmly tube end face, and to rotate shape The progressive reduction pipe material inner wall of formula encloses, and expands the aperture of plastic pipe end face by the rotation of internal diameter cutter 22 with this.Due to upper State the structure construction and its action form of equipment, " a kind of plastic pipe screw thread adds in the present inventor's earlier application entitled The clamping structure of work machine " (201820525983.4) and " a kind of plastic pipe thread generator " (201810332152.X's) is special It is recorded in sharp application documents.
It is provided by the invention it is a kind of process plastic pipe thread mechanism embodiment in, although using above equipment as base Plinth, but its technical essential disclosed is not identical, such as:
It please refers to shown in Fig. 3 a and Fig. 3 b, Fig. 3 a and Fig. 3 b are the thread mechanisms of the present embodiment processing plastic pipe, equally Thread mechanism 20 including being located at the top of slide block mechanism 10 top, thread mechanism 20 include 21 back side motor (not marking) of side plate and hang Rotating device (not shown or do not mark) in the front of side plate 21, wherein:Motor is located at the top of slide block mechanism 10 top, motor driven Axis (not shown) is driven in axis connection first (not shown), and first, which drives axis, drives axis 201 by axis or chain or band transmission second (not shown) (such as Fig. 6), the first, second drive axis 201 are each passed through side plate 21, and convex in 21 front of side plate with side-by-side fashion.In the present embodiment In, rotating device includes the internal diameter cutter 22 being located on the second drive axis 201 and is located at tri-claw plate 23 on the first drive axis, or including The outer diameter cutter 24 that is located on the second drive axis 201 and it is located at the first drive axis upper plate chain wheel 25.When being processed to plastic pipe, Internal diameter cutter 22 and tri-claw plate 23 can be moved left and right by control mechanism driving slide block mechanism 10 drive (not shown), be made with this Both (i.e. internal diameter cutter 22 and tri-claw plate 23) rotation is directed at the plastic pipe being clamped on clamp system 30, thus realization pair The internal diameter whorl of plastic pipe be made or outer diameter cutter 24 and screw die disk 25 can be slided by control mechanism driving (not shown) The drive of block mechanism 10 moves left and right, and makes both (i.e. outer diameter cutter 24 and screw die disk 25) rotation alignment be clamped in clamping with this Plastic pipe in mechanism 30, to realize being made to the outer-diameter threads of plastic pipe.
In the present embodiment, internal diameter cutter 22 includes the basic portion (not marking) that is connected on the second drive axis 201 and with base Our department is the first, second bar portion 221,222 of concentric shafts, wherein:First bar portion 221 is connected to basic portion and the second bar portion 222 Between, and the diameter of the first bar portion 221 is greater than the diameter of the second bar portion 222, is convexly equipped with rose reamer in 221 periphery of the first bar portion 2211, the seam allowance knife 2221 that can expand internal diameter is equipped in the second bar portion 222, when internal diameter cutter 22 is moved to by slide block mechanism 10 After being directed at plastic pipe to be processed, the starting of slide block mechanism 10 is pushed ahead, the band that internal diameter cutter 22 drives axis 201 second at this time Dynamic lower rotation, the operation for expanding internal diameter is realized with this;After being advanced into set depth, the starting of slide block mechanism 10 is exited back.Together Sample, tri-claw plate 23 is clamped with internal thread cutter 231, and internal thread cutter 231 is moved to through internal diameter cutter 22 by slide block mechanism 10 After finished plastic pipe, the starting of slide block mechanism 10 is pushed ahead, and tri-claw plate 23 rotates under the drive of the first drive axis at this time, The operation for expanding internal sealing plug is realized with this;After being advanced into set depth, the starting of slide block mechanism 10 is exited back, and to mould with this Expects pipe material is processed into internal screw thread.
In the present embodiment, the replaceable internal diameter cutter 22 of outer diameter cutter 24 (such as Fig. 4 a and Fig. 5, Fig. 6) connects second and drives axis 201, and including driving shaft 241, driven shaft 242, shaft seat 243, deflection seat 244, outer diameter chamfering cutterhead 245, outer diameter cutterhead 246 With the first, second spacer sleeve 247,248 and clump weight 249, wherein:Driving shaft 241 is installed on shaft seat 243, and including two It holds perforative centre bore (not marking), driving shaft 241 drives shaft seat 243 to rotate by connection the second drive axis 201;Driven shaft 242 are set in driving shaft 241 in the form of through centre bore, and the master gear 2421 being equipped with including one end;It is fixed to deflect seat 244 In 243 side of shaft seat, and it is equipped with eccentric shaft 2441, master gear 2421 is corresponded on eccentric shaft 2441 and is equipped with by the master gear The slave gear 2442 of 2421 drivings makes eccentric shaft 2441 drive rotation by master gear 2421 with this;Outer diameter chamfering cutterhead 245 And outer diameter cutterhead 246 is successively fixed on eccentric shaft 2441, and is rotated simultaneously with eccentric shaft 2441, wherein:From gear 2442 with It is additionally provided with the first spacer sleeve 247 on eccentric shaft 2441 between outer diameter chamfering cutterhead 245, is used to adjust outer diameter chamfering cutterhead with this 245 meet the spacing in plastic pipe to be processed;Eccentric shaft between outer diameter rose reamer disk 245 and outer diameter cutterhead 246 It is additionally provided with the second spacer sleeve 248 on 2441, is used to adjust the spacing of outer diameter cutterhead 246 Yu outer diameter chamfering cutterhead 245 with this;
In the present embodiment, axis, screw die disk 25 are driven in the replaceable connection of tri-claw plate 23 first of screw die disk 25 (please referring to Fig. 4 b) Outer silk cutter 251 including meeting the finished plastic pipe size of outer diameter cutter 24 is used to process the outer of plastic pipe with this Screw thread.In the present embodiment, external screw thread meets internal screw thread twist-on.In the present embodiment, the diameter of plastic pipe internal and external screw thread is big The cutter of small optional dimension is realized, however it is not limited to which the cutter in the present embodiment, the cutter of the present embodiment include chamfering Knife 2211, seam allowance knife 2221 and internal thread cutter 231 and sequentially it is matched with rose reamer 2211, seam allowance knife 2221 and internal thread cutter 231 outer diameter chamfering cutterhead 245, outer diameter cutterhead 246 and outer silk cutter 251.
